Why Become a CNA?

With the aging ⁢population and ⁤increased healthcare needs,⁢ CNAs play a crucial role in providing essential patient⁤ care. Here are some compelling reasons to consider becoming a‍ CNA:

  • High Demand: The U.S.Bureau of Labor Statistics projects a growth ⁣rate ‍of 8% for nursing assistants⁤ through 2030, ensuring ample job opportunities.
  • Short Training Period: ‌ CNA programs typically ⁢last between 4-12 weeks, allowing ​for a rapid​ transition into the ‍workforce.
  • Strong Job Security: Those entering the healthcare field are more likely to find stable and secure job positions.
  • Pathway to Advanced Roles: Starting as a CNA can pave the way for further education⁣ and specialties in nursing.

Key Components of CNA Training

CNA training programs generally consist of both classroom instruction and practical hands-on ⁢experience. here are the typical components:

  • theory Classes: Cover topics‍ such as anatomy, hygiene, infection control, and ‌patient rights.
  • Clinical Practice: Students gain real-world experience ‍in⁢ various​ healthcare settings, learning essential skills‍ such⁤ as bathing, feeding, ​and taking vital signs.
  • Certification⁣ Preparation: Most programs⁤ include preparation for ⁣the state certification ​examination required ‌in Colorado.
